HP R1500 G2 UPS |
| HP Rack-mountable UPSs provide maximum uptime
in the event of a power problem for a variety of rack-based computer systems,
providing powerful performance while occupying minimal rack space.
The HP R1500 G2 UPS is a 1U, high power density solution designed for customers who want to provide power protection, for maximum uptime and data corruption avoidance, in space-constrained rack environments. In addition, the R1500 G2 can be connected to the host server via the USB port for UPS management. |

| 1U Power Packed Design |
| Rated up to1500VA/1000W, the HP UPS R1500 G2 packs more power in space-conserving rack-mount design, allowing you to support more critical equipment in your rack. |
|
|
| Lower Cost of Ownership with Innovative Technology |
| The UPS R1500 G2 utilizes a line-interactive topology which features sine wave output and superior input/output voltage regulation. This technology is inherently reliable and highly efficient. The HP UPS can correct input voltage variations as low as -23% of nominal voltage without transferring to the battery. This will ensure the battery is preserved and ready for the next power anomaly |
|
|
| Investment Protection with HP Enhanced Battery Management |
| The UPS R1500 G2 incorporates Enhanced Battery Management: an exclusive, patented technology that doubles battery service life, optimizes battery recharge time, and provides advance notice of pending battery failure. With Enhanced Battery Management, you have a lower total cost of ownership and receive the best in the industry protection for your critical equipment. |
|
|
| Intelligent Manageability |
| HP Power Manager management software, an integrated component of HP Insight Manager, the industry-leading hardware management platform, is included with the R1500 G2 models. The HP Power Management Software enables you to monitor and control HP UPSs locally or remotely. This software is a versatile, fully configurable, alert response tool that gives system administrators a full overview of the network's conditions. It enables you to monitor system status and power conditions, configure shut down timing, customize alert messages, and perform UPS diagnostic checks quickly and easily. |
| |
| Independently Controllable Load Segments |
| With two independent controlled load segments, you have the flexibility to configure each segment's, scheduled startups and shutdowns. Working in conjunction with HP Power Management Software, the HP UPS R1500 G2 can be configured to extend the runtime for more critical devices. |
|
|
| Ease of Maintenance with Hot-Swappable Batteries |
| The UPS R1500 G2 is modular in design, and the batteries are hot swappable. HP UPSs are designed with simple access through the front panel. Users can safely install new batteries without ever powering down connected server and server options. |

| Warranty |
| The HP UPS R1500 G2 is covered by a three
year warranty, with the first year including parts and labor. Also, standard
on all HP UPS units is our exclusive Pre-Failure Warranty which extends
the advantage of a HP three-year, limited warranty by applying it to the
battery before it actually fails. This warranty is offered worldwide. Specifically,
the Pre-Failure Battery Warranty ensures that when customers receive notification
from HP Power Management Software that the battery may fail, the battery
is replaced free of charge under the warranty. NOTE: $250,000 Computer/Load Protection Guarantee is also provided, in addition to the HP three year, limited warranty. |

| Optional UPS Management Module |
The HP UPS Management Module enables you to monitor and manage power environments through comprehensive control of HP UPSs. The HP UPS Management Module can support either a single UPS configuration or provides additional power protection with support for dual redundant UPS configuration for no-single-point-of-failure. The additional serial ports will provide greater power management control and flexible monitoring. The management module can be configured to send alert traps to HP Systems Insight Manager and other SNMP management programs or used as a standalone management system. This flexibility enables you to monitor and manage UPSs through the network. To facilitate day-to-day maintenance tasks, the embedded management software provides detailed system logs. The HP UPS Management Module provides remote management of a UPS by connecting the UPS directly to the network. Configuration & Management of the UPS from anywhere and at anytime via a standard web browser. NOTE: For more information on the UPS

Technical Specifications
| Unit Dimensions | 19.1 x 1.75 x 23.0 in (48.51 x 4.44 x 58.42 cm) | |
| Shipping Dimensions | 32 x 11.5 x 26.75 in (81.28 x 29.21 x 67.95 cm) | |
| Unit Weight | 60 lb (27.2 kg) | |
| Shipping Weight | 76 lb (34.5 kg) | |
| Electrical Input | Voltage Range | 100, 120 and 230V models. See Model Matrix for nominal and user selectable voltage settings via the rear panel dip switch |
| Frequency | 50/60 Hz ± 5Hz (auto sensing) | |
| Input Plug | See Model Matrix | |
| Online Efficiency | 95% | |
| Surge Suppression | High Energy 6500A peak | |
| Electrical Output | Online Regulation | -10% to +6% of nominal voltage |
| On battery Regulation | ±5% of nominal voltage | |
| Voltage Wave Form | Sine wave | |
| Connections | See Model Selection Matrix; divided into 2 Load Segments | |
| Output Protection | Re-settable circuit protectors (HV models only AF418A) | |
| Battery | Type | Maintenance-free, sealed, valve-regulated lead acid (VRLA) |
| Backup Time | See Backup Times Chart | |
| Recharge Time | <4 hours to 90% usable capacity; <24 hours for complete recharge | |
| Voltage | 36V Battery String | |
| Communications | Ports | Standard DB-9 port (ships with
communication cable) USB port (ships with communication cable) |
| Option Slot | One | |
| Option Cards | SNMP / Serial Port Card | |
| LED Indicators | LED display integrated into the front panel | |
| Software | HP Power Manager management software | |
| Environmental and Safety | Operating Temperature | 50° to 104° F (10° to 40° C) |
| Transit Temperature | -5° to 131° F (-15° to 55° C) | |
| Storage Temperature | 32° to 77° F (0° to 25° C ) | |
| Humidity (Operation) | 20% to 80% (non-condensing) | |
| Humidity (Non-operating) | 5% to 95% | |
| Operating Altitude | Up to 10,000 ft (3048 m) above sea level | |
| Storage Altitude | 30,000 ft (9,144 m) above sea level | |
| Audible Noise | <46db (at 1m from surface of unit) | |
| Safety Markings | UL/cUL ICES, GS, GOST, EK | |
| Safety Certifications | UL1778; UL6950, CSA22.2 No.107.1,No.107.2,No.950; CB Bulletin No.86AI; EN50091-1; EN60950; | |
| EMC Markings | FCC-A; CISPR 22; VCCI-A; CE, BSMI, C-TICK | |
| Emissions | FCC CFR 47, Part 15 Class A, EN50091-2 | |
| Immunity | IEC 801-2, IEC 801-3, IEC 801-4, IEC 801-5 | |
| Surge Suppression | Conforms to IEEE 587B and ANSI C62.41 | |
